Latest Patents

Salaita's latest patents showcase his expertise in creating advanced materials. One of his notable inventions is related to strain-accommodating materials comprising photonic crystals. This patent describes non-naturally occurring light-reflecting or color-changing materials that utilize a segmented array of flexible polymers embedded with photonic crystal lattices. These materials are designed to maintain a near-constant size during chromatic shifting, making them highly versatile for various applications.

Another significant patent focuses on polynucleotide-based movement, kits, and methods related to DNA. This invention involves the movement of objects using DNA-based mechanisms. In specific embodiments, particles or rods are conjugated with single-stranded DNA that hybridizes to single-stranded RNA on a substrate. The interaction between the DNA and RNA, particularly in the presence of endonucleases, facilitates movement along the surface, with the complementarity affecting the velocity of the particles.
